Assessing PLC Systems: Allen-Bradley, Siemens, and ABB
When choosing a PLC system for industrial application, it's essential to carefully compare the offerings from leading manufacturers like Allen-Bradley, Siemens, and ABB. Each provider brings its own strengths and weaknesses to the table, making it crucial to consider factors such as performance, reliability, programming options, and budget. Allen-Bradley is well-known for its robust equipment and user-friendly software platform, making it a popular option in the North American market. Siemens, on the other hand, boasts a comprehensive product portfolio that spans across various industries and applications, with a strong focus on automation and control. ABB stands out for its innovative approaches in areas such as robotics and drives, supported by a global network of assistance.
Ultimately, the best PLC system for a particular project will depend on the particular requirements of your application.
